I work with veterans. Thus I see many patients who suffer post-traumatic stress disorder, or what is more commonly referred to as PTSD. It has been estimated that 19 percent of all Vietnam veterans returned home with symptoms of PTSD and that 25 years later, 9 percent continued to suffer. A recent report by the Rand Corporation similarly concludes that 20 percent of the veterans of the Iraq and Afghanistan wars have the signs and symptoms of PTSD.
